ALLOA came from behind to claim a draw at Partick Thistle on Saturday, with a number of Wasps starts turning in fine performances.

Neil Parry........................6

A couple of big stops kept Alloa in the game. Could do nothing on any of the goals.

Scott Taggart....................7

Another enterprising performance from the fullback who worked hard and helped support Kevin Cawley.

Liam Dick.......................7

Continued his good form with another excellent display. A threat going forward and did well defensively.

Sam Roscoe.....................8

Arguably his best game in an Alloa shirt, defended valiantly as Thistle looked for the winner at the end.

Andy Graham...................8

After a poor performance last week, was back to his usual standard and led the backline well.

Steven Hetherington........6

Worked hard all day but his passing could have been better at times.

Iain Flannigan..................6

The conditions made it difficult for the ex-Jag to exert his usual authority and his set piece delivery was unusually poor.

Kevin Cawley (off 66).....6

Took his goal really well and buzzed about as always, but too easily outmuscled on a number of occasions.

Jake Hastie......................7

Silly foul on the penalty but otherwise a threatening performance from the young Motherwell laonee.

Alan Trouten (off 83)......6

Wonderful play to assist the first Alloa goal but faded and hardly influenced the game thereafter.

Dario Zanatta**...............8

He had been due a goal after plenty of encouraging signs lately and duly delivered. A superb performance.

Jon Robertson (on 83)...6

Thrown on to help the Wasps secure the draw and did exactly that.

Connor Shields (on 66)....6

The Sunderland loanee tried to find the winner and worked hard.
